Sir – The use of RAF fighters to shoot down Iranian drones bound for Israel will result in retaliator­y action by Iran in the form of attacks on British shipping navigating through the Strait of Hormuz. This irresponsi­ble disregard for the lives of British seafarers is reprehensi­ble.

Throughout my 44-year career in the Merchant Navy, I had to look down the wrong end of an Islamic Revolution­ary Guard’s weapon on a number of occasions. I’ve been fired on in the Strait by Boghammar patrol boats armed with half-inch machine guns, intercepte­d by an Iranian warship within a cable of Dubai’s breakwater (only to be saved by the timely arrival of a Royal Navy destroyer), and very nearly shot dead on arrival by air at Bandar Abbas airport.

The Royal Navy no longer has sufficient capacity to protect our merchant fleet. The British Government needs to stop giving token assistance to our American allies without first stopping to consider the danger this causes to seafarers. Bombing Yemen has already resulted in attacks on British shipping, and this situation can only now get a lot worse. Peter J Newton

Retired Merchant Navy captain Chellaston, Derbyshire
